Excessive Electronic Media Exposure in Developing Sleep Disorders and Behavior Problems Among Preschool Children

Abstract:
Background: The continuous revolution of electronic media has many negative effects on preschool children as sleep disorders, behavioral problems, obesity, cognitive and language problems, and social-emotional delay. The aim of the present study was to assess the effect of excessive electronic media exposure in developing sleep disorders and behavior problems among preschool children. Subjects and Methods: A prospective descriptive research design was used to conduct the present study where 160 mothers of preschool children were selected by using a multistage cluster sampling technique attending four governmental nursery schools in Zagazig city. Data were collected by using an interview questionnaire sheet composed of four parts: socio-demographic data, electronic media exposure questionnaire, sleep disturbance scale for children in preschool age, and strengths and difficulties questionnaire. Results: The study results revealed that 96.7% of children who exposed to media for more than 4 hours daily have high sleep disorders at second measurement compared to first one. Regarding strengths and difficulties questionnaire, the study results revealed that there was a statistically significant positive correlation between hours of child exposure to media and negative strengths and difficulties questionnaire. Conclusion: The study concluded that increasing hours of daily exposure to media associated with high levels of sleep disorders and behavior problems among preschool children. Recommendations: It is recommended that health education programs for caregivers about the negative effects of excessive exposure to electronic media on sleep and behaviors among preschool children.
